I use two HDDs (one internal to my laptop, and one external) that I normally backup on to a third backup hard drive.

Is it possible to do a backup of just one of the non-backup-drives so that it doesn't take as long to back up?

If so, will I be able to re-include the external hdd? In the next backup?

The W7 backup automatically selects the OS partition and cannot be de-selected.

This is why I use Acronis, back up any partition or disk you wish. http://www.acronis.com/homecomputing/products/trueimage/
